crispness |
||
| 1. | [ noun ] a pleasing firmness and freshness | |
| Examples: | : "crispness of new dollar bills" "crispness of fresh lettuce" |
|
| Related terms: | freshness | |
| 2. | [ noun ] a style of expression that is direct and to the point | |
| Examples: | "the crispness of his reply" |
|
| Related terms: | terseness | |
| 3. | [ noun ] firm but easily broken | |
| Synonyms: | crispiness brittleness | |
| Related terms: | breakableness flakiness | |
